17-08-16, 06:03 AM
(آخر تعديل لهذه المشاركة : 17-08-16, 06:07 AM {2} بواسطة اسلام الكبابى.)
هذا هو الكود الذى أعرفه
فهل من كود أسهل من ذلك بحيث لا يمر على جميع السجلات(500 سجل مثلآ)
و فى كل مرة يقرأ الشرط If .Fields("AGE") > 60 Then .Fields("SALARY") =4000
ليعدل لى فى النهاية 4 أو 5 سجلات مثلآ
ولكم ألف شكر
هذا هو الكود الذى أعرفه
فهل من كود أسهل من ذلك بحيث لا يمر على جميع السجلات(500 سجل مثلآ)
و فى كل مرة يقرأ الشرط If .Fields("AGE") > 60 Then .Fields("SALARY") =4000
ليعدل لى فى النهاية 4 أو 5 سجلات مثلآ
ولكم ألف شكر
كود :
[align=left]With Adodc1.Recordset[/align]
[align=left].MoveFirst[/align]
[align=left]Do Until .EOF[/align]
[align=left]If .Fields("AGE") > 60 Then .Fields("SALARY") = 4000: .Update[/align]
[align=left]If Not .EOF Then .MoveNext[/align]
[align=left]Loop[/align]
[align=left]End With[/align]فهل من كود أسهل من ذلك بحيث لا يمر على جميع السجلات(500 سجل مثلآ)
و فى كل مرة يقرأ الشرط If .Fields("AGE") > 60 Then .Fields("SALARY") =4000
ليعدل لى فى النهاية 4 أو 5 سجلات مثلآ
ولكم ألف شكر
هذا هو الكود الذى أعرفه
PHP كود :
With Adodc1.Recordset
.MoveFirst
Do Until .EOF
If .Fields("AGE") > 60 Then .Fields("SALARY") = 4000: .Update
If Not .EOF Then .MoveNext
Loop
End With
و فى كل مرة يقرأ الشرط If .Fields("AGE") > 60 Then .Fields("SALARY") =4000
ليعدل لى فى النهاية 4 أو 5 سجلات مثلآ
ولكم ألف شكر


